Park feature 1️⃣9️⃣ of 1️⃣9️⃣: Aiken County Recreation Center - 917 Jefferson Davis Hwy
This six-acre community recreation area has a special history. Originally developed by Gregg-Graniteville Mill for its African American employees and their families, the property was later transferred to Aiken County and became the Aiken County Recreation Center.
Following a major renovation that began in August 2025, the center now offers updated spaces and amenities while preserving longtime favorites.
✨ Park features include:
* New outdoor basketball courts
* Swimming pool and bathhouse
* Playground areas
* Walking trail/track
* Picnic shelter with grill
* Multipurpose community rooms with kitchen
* Leashed dogs welcome
* Improved parking and redesigned drop-off area
The renovation was funded through Aiken County’s Capital Project Sales Tax and was designed to modernize the facility while keeping the amenities the community already loves.
The recreation center also offers community programming, seasonal activities such as our annual Joe Jackson School Supply Giveaway, Spooktacular and Christmas Assistance Giveaway, as well as a supervised summer day camp featuring games, crafts, and swimming.
